A skill for designing or repairing a software testing strategy around observable behavior. TDD, or test-driven development, is one testing approach, but this skill focuses more broadly on choosing tests that prove important contracts and failure cases.

In plain words
What is it for?
Use it to decide between unit, integration, end-to-end, property, load, contract, and manual tests, and to check compatibility across system boundaries.
Why use it?
It helps avoid relying on unsuitable, flaky, or unnecessarily expensive tests and controls sources of unpredictable results.

Test a code system

Build proof around failures the system must detect. Coverage percentage is a signal, not the test strategy. Do not load bundled references when this skill activates.

Define the proof obligation

  1. State the contract, observable outcome, boundary owner, and failure modes.
  2. Identify which dependencies are part of the behavior and which can be replaced without invalidating the proof.
  3. Map each risk to the cheapest level that can observe it: unit, component, contract, integration, end-to-end, property, load, or manual runtime check.

Design resilient tests

Prefer public behavior and stable seams over private calls. Make fixtures minimal, explicit, and semantically meaningful. Control time, randomness, identity, concurrency, network, filesystem, and external services at the boundary that owns them—not at every layer.
